As we enter 2024, the world of interior design is witnessing exciting changes, especially in custom bathrooms. Once considered merely functional spaces, bathrooms are transformed into luxurious retreats that reflect personal style and enhance comfort.
One of the most significant trends in 2024 is incorporating spa-like features into custom bathrooms. Homeowners are increasingly looking to create a serene atmosphere that promotes relaxation and wellness.
Freestanding soaking tubs are becoming a focal point in many custom bathroom designs. These tubs add a touch of elegance and provide a perfect spot for unwinding after a long day. Paired with rain showerheads, which mimic the feeling of gentle rainfall, these features create a luxurious bathing experience.
Integrating aromatherapy diffusers and built-in sound systems is another way to enhance the spa-like ambiance. Homeowners can customize their bathing experience with soothing scents and calming music, turning their bathrooms into personal sanctuaries.
Sustainability continues to be a driving force in interior design, and custom bathrooms are no exception. In 2024, eco-friendly materials and water-saving fixtures are gaining popularity.
Low-flow faucets and showerheads are widely adopted to reduce water consumption without sacrificing performance. These fixtures help the environment and lower utility bills, making them a practical choice for homeowners.
Natural materials such as bamboo, reclaimed wood, and recycled tiles are favored for their minimal environmental impact. These materials add warmth and character to the bathroom while promoting sustainability.
While neutral tones have dominated bathroom designs in recent years, 2024 is seeing a resurgence of bold colors and patterns. Homeowners are becoming more adventurous with their choices, using vibrant hues to express their personalities.
Accent walls featuring bold wallpaper or textured tiles are becoming popular. These statement walls serve as a focal point, adding depth and interest to the space. Whether it's a geometric pattern or a rich, deep color, these walls can dramatically change the bathroom's overall look.
In addition to walls, colorful fixtures such as sinks, bathtubs, and even toilets are returning. Homeowners are opting for unique colors that stand out and create a memorable aesthetic.
The rise of smart home technology is transforming custom bathrooms into high-tech havens. In 2024, homeowners increasingly incorporate intelligent features that enhance convenience and efficiency.
Smart showers allow users to control temperature and water flow through smartphones or voice commands, providing a tailored shower experience. Similarly, intelligent toilets with features like heated seats, bidet functions, and automatic flushing are gaining traction.
Smart lighting systems that can be adjusted for brightness and color temperature are also becoming more common. With these systems, homeowners can create the perfect ambiance for any time of day, whether bright and energizing or soft and relaxing.
As bathrooms become more customized, efficient storage solutions are paramount. In 2024, homeowners focus on creating personalized storage options that blend functionality with style.
Custom cabinetry that fits the specific dimensions of the bathroom is increasingly popular. These built-in solutions maximize space while providing a seamless look. Open shelving also makes a statement, allowing for the decorative storage of towels and toiletries.
Vanities that double as storage units or benches are becoming common. These multi-functional pieces help keep the bathroom organized while adding a stylish element to the design.
